Door hinge welding refers to the process of permanently connecting door hinges to a door frame or door browse the application of heat. This technique is vital for creating strong, trusted, and durable connections that ensure smooth operation and longevity of the door. Welded door hinges are commonly utilized in commercial, commercial, and residential settings. Methods for Door Hinge Welding There are numerous welding strategies that can be used when attaching door hinges. The option of technique normally depends upon the product of the door and hinge, in addition to the specific application requirements. Common Welding Techniques MIG Welding (Metal Inert Gas Welding) Description: MIG welding utilizes a constant strong wire electrode and a protecting gas to protect the weld swimming pool from contamination. Advantages: Fast and efficient, ideal for thin materials, and supplies a tidy finish. Benefits: Offers high precision and control, ideal for thicker products and more complex applications. Stick Welding (Shielded Metal Arc Welding) Description: Stick welding involves utilizing a consumable electrode covered in flux to create the weld and shield the arc from contamination. Advantages: Versatile and can be used outdoors or in windy conditions. Finest Practices for Door Hinge Welding Welding door hinges may appear simple, but following finest practices guarantees a successful outcome. Here are some essential factors to consider: Material Compatibility Guarantee that the hinge and door material are suitable with the picked welding technique. Appropriate Alignment Before welding, line up the hinge properly to prevent misalignment that can lead to practical issues. Tidy Surfaces Tidy the surface areas to be welded to remove pollutants such as rust, paint, or grease, which can impact the quality of the weld. Utilize the Right Equipment Select appropriate devices and consumables for the welding procedure to guarantee ideal outcomes. Quality Control After welding, examine the joint for connection and strength through visual examinations or nondestructive testing techniques.
